Transaction 621bdb2e6c80cfc18a2b7832f0c283a13b5e8f966cc9ebf864eaaea1196368ea
1 Input
1 Output
-
621bdb2e6c80cfc18a2b7832f0c283a13b5e8f966cc9ebf864eaaea1196368ea:0
- value
- 3465696
- script pubkey
- OP_0 OP_PUSHBYTES_20 19f13aad124bba1fadd76c49b8cc35cd83473c08
- address
- bc1qr8cn4tgjfwapltwhd3ym3np4ekp5w0qgg035e5